Where to Find Exclusive Anime Merchandise Online: A Comprehensive Guide
For avid anime enthusiasts, finding exclusive anime merchandise online can be a thrilling adventure. One of the best places to start is through official anime studio websites or their partnered retailers. Many studios release limited edition items, such as signed collectibles, rare art books, and unique apparel. Additionally, checking platforms like Amazon or eBay can yield impressive finds as sellers often list one-of-a-kind items that aren’t available anywhere else.
Another option is to explore specialty stores that focus on anime goods. Websites like Right Stuf Anime and Anime North cater specifically to fans, providing a curated selection of exclusive anime merchandise. Furthermore, don’t forget to check out social media platforms for independent artists and creators who frequently sell unique handmade items. Engaging with the anime community on forums such as Reddit or Discord can also lead to opportunities to discover hidden gems!
How to Spot Authentic vs. Bootleg Anime Merch: Tips for Collectors
As a collector, spotting authentic anime merchandise is crucial to ensuring the value and integrity of your collection. One of the first things to look for is official branding. Authentic merchandise often includes a logo or trademark from the original creator or studio. Additionally, examining the packaging can provide significant clues—genuine products typically have high-quality printing and clear designs, whereas bootleg items may exhibit poor-quality printing or misspellings. Don’t forget to check the materials used; legitimate merchandise is made with high-grade materials, while counterfeit items often use cheaper alternatives.
Another essential factor to consider is seller reputation. When purchasing items online or at conventions, always research the seller's reviews and ratings. Authentic products tend to be sold by reputable retailers or directly from the official website of the anime series. Furthermore, paying attention to price points can help you spot potential fakes; if a deal seems too good to be true, it likely is. Lastly, interacting with fellow collectors can provide valuable insights and even warnings about notorious bootleggers, helping you refine your eye for authentic anime merchandise.
